WebIn July, 2010, a mall group of Friends of Mekele Blind School spent 3 weeks making further needed improvements at the school. We installed an extensive rope-rail, which is proving to be a huge confidence builder for the children. It is now much easier for them to move around the 10 acre compound more independently. WebThree of the five schools for the blind in Ethiopia were selected for this study. Bako, which is located 250 kilometres west of Addis Ababa, and Shashemene located 250 kilometres south of the capital, represent the rural setting. Sebeta is near an urban centre, being located just 20 kilometres outside Addis Ababa.
